This is call for help to the sales experts. Here's my situation. I'm in a bind. I got into real estate about a year ago when I got out of school and was immediately introduced by a friend to an investor who bought and sold a lot of homes. All the time I've been the listing agent for the investor. All of my income came from this gig. He just closed shop. No notice, no nothing and now I'm out in the cold. I desperately need to find a way to make money. I don't have any listings because all of my time was spent on selling that guys homes. I only have less than a month of income in savings so I'm basically screwed. I don't have any friends or family in the area and I've never had to find my own listings so if I want to stay in real estate I'd be starting from scratch. The market is not good today so basically I think I'm going to have to do something else unless I can come up with a plan. If you were in my position what would you do?

If your suggestion is to get out of real estate what sales jobs do you think are in demand?
